Output 332974581ec633f20147b4c61fac84c4f78405f9c81f00aaedc62ab5816083ae:0

value
163306657
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 901675ed4d59dd56e974a179dc0ca94fa32e1bad OP_EQUALVERIFY OP_CHECKSIG
address
1E8sDDbApHGCaTmwePPmtC7gZ95vhvGxgo
transaction
332974581ec633f20147b4c61fac84c4f78405f9c81f00aaedc62ab5816083ae
spent
true